Frequently Asked Questions about Québec

How much are Studio apartments in Québec?

There are currently 177 Studio Apartments in Québec with rent ranges from $871 to $1,400 with an average price of $1,958.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Québec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Québec ranges from $950 to $3,450 with an average monthly rent of $1,725.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Québec c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Québec range from $1,595 to $4,950.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,293.

How expensive are Québec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 92 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Québec on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,795 to $3,599 - averaging $2,678 for the location.
